Bard Graduate Center Exchange
Between January and March 2020 I was selected for the V&A / RCA exchange with the Bard Graduate Center in New York. I was joined by fellow student Fleur Elkerton, and had the opportunity to audit a range of teaching and form international research connections.
I audited both Jennifer Mass’ ‘Twelve Critical Topics in Cultural Heritage Science for the Humanities Scholar’ and Meredith Lynn and Caspar Meyer’s ‘Digital Archaeological Heritage’. Both modules have had long-lasting impact on my academic and professional practice. I use the material literacy and technical skills I learned on a daily basis.
Outside of teaching, I was keen to interface with the Center’s ‘Cultures of Conservation’ project, and had some really enriching meetings with conservator and lecturer Soon Kai Poh. I also participated in a number of training sessions covering collections’ photography, GIS systems and giving gallery tours.
The visit was dramatically cut short by the COVID-19 pandemic — Fleur and I booked our flights just before the USNS Comfort sailed up the Hudson river to aid the city’s hospitals. A gallery of my film photographs from the time can be found below.
